Cordoba, Spain - July 2005

There's really not a lot to do in Cordoba except for visiting the famous Mezquita cathedral which is actually a mix between a cathedral and a mosque. But it definitely is worth visiting. The building was originally built by the Moors and built as a Mosque but then it was captured by the Spanish Christians, then back by the Moors and one last time by the Christians.
